[OE-core] [PATCH 00/16] Misc Qt4 and udev changes pending from O.S. Systems

Saul Wold sgw at linux.intel.com
Thu Jan 5 20:25:52 UTC 2012


On 01/03/2012 04:24 PM, Saul Wold wrote:
> On 12/28/2011 11:55 AM, Otavio Salvador wrote:
>> This patchset includes our pending changes for Qt4 and udev. The udev
>> patchset does a great cleanup on the udev package reducing a lot the
>> delta between OE-Core and Meta-OE. Am working at updating the udev to
>> 175 but those patches are the basis for this.
>>
>> Those has been tested under imx53qsb and O.S. Systems' x86 based
>> machine definition using internal images running Qt4, Qt4-Embedded,
>> SysV and SystemD.
>>
>> The following changes since commit
>> 8f348ccad083d6c02c200652ff6295e701e88f0d:
>>
>> coreutils: ensure --color works so DEPEND on libcap (2011-12-24
>> 10:05:35 +0000)
>>
>> are available in the git repository at:
>> git://github.com/OSSystems/oe-core master
>> https://github.com/OSSystems/oe-core/tree/HEAD
>>
>> Otavio Salvador (16):
>> qt4-graphics-system: add
>> qt4e.bbclass: add QT_BASE_NAME for use in recipes
>> qt4x11.bbclass: add QT_BASE_NAME for use in recipes
>> qt4-embedded.inc: use QT_BASE_NAME from qt4e.bbclass
>> qt4-x11-free.inc: use QT_BASE_NAME from qt4x11.bbclass
>
> I already commented on these with xserver-common
>
>> udev: drop 145 version
>> udev-extraconf: move mount.blacklist to udev-extraconf dir
>> udev: reorganize files of 164 version
>> udev: use tabs for init script (no code changes)
>> udev: skip mounting /dev on tmpfs if it is on devtmpfs
> These first 5 were merged into OE-Core
>
>> udev: ensure /dev/pts and /dev/shm does exists
>> udev: improve udev-cache robustness
>> udev: use 'echo' instead of 'echo -n' in init script
Merged
>> udev: run depmod if modules.dep doesn't exist
>> udev: split utilities onto udev-utils
>> udev: remove commented code from init script (no code changes)
Merged these last 2.
>>
> Richard is reviewing this in more detail.
>
Merged 3 more of these into OE-Core

Thanks
	Sau!

> Thanks
> Sau!
>
>
>> meta/classes/qt4e.bbclass | 1 +
>> meta/classes/qt4x11.bbclass | 1 +
>> meta/recipes-core/udev/files/fix-alignment.patch | 26 -
>> meta/recipes-core/udev/files/init | 212 ------
>> meta/recipes-core/udev/files/local.rules | 22 -
>> meta/recipes-core/udev/files/noasmlinkage.patch | 39 -
>> meta/recipes-core/udev/files/permissions.rules | 81 --
>> meta/recipes-core/udev/files/tmpfs.patch | 17 -
>> meta/recipes-core/udev/files/udev-cache | 20 -
>> meta/recipes-core/udev/files/udev.rules | 98 ---
>> meta/recipes-core/udev/files/udev_network_queue.sh | 35 -
>> meta/recipes-core/udev/files/udevsynthesize.patch | 778
>> --------------------
>> meta/recipes-core/udev/files/udevsynthesize.sh | 51 --
>> meta/recipes-core/udev/udev-145/enable-gudev.patch | 50 --
>> meta/recipes-core/udev/udev-145/init | 59 --
>> meta/recipes-core/udev/udev-145/local.rules | 33 -
>> meta/recipes-core/udev/udev-145/noasmlinkage.patch | 50 --
>> meta/recipes-core/udev/udev-145/unbreak.patch | 26 -
>> meta/recipes-core/udev/udev-164/init | 59 --
>> meta/recipes-core/udev/udev-164/permissions.rules | 131 ----
>> meta/recipes-core/udev/udev-164/run.rules | 14 -
>> meta/recipes-core/udev/udev-164/udev.rules | 116 ---
>> .../udev/{files => udev-extraconf}/mount.blacklist | 0
>> meta/recipes-core/udev/udev-new.inc | 91 ---
>> meta/recipes-core/udev/udev.inc | 108 ++--
>> .../udev/{files => udev}/devfs-udev.rules | 0
>> meta/recipes-core/udev/udev/init | 76 ++
>> meta/recipes-core/udev/{files => udev}/links.conf | 0
>> .../udev/{udev-164 => udev}/local.rules | 0
>> meta/recipes-core/udev/{files => udev}/mount.sh | 0
>> meta/recipes-core/udev/{files => udev}/network.sh | 0
>> .../udev/{udev-145 => udev}/permissions.rules | 0
>> .../recipes-core/udev/{udev-145 => udev}/run.rules | 0
>> .../udev/{files => udev}/udev-166-v4l1-1.patch | 0
>> meta/recipes-core/udev/udev/udev-cache | 34 +
>> meta/recipes-core/udev/udev/udev-cache.default | 4 +
>> .../udev/{udev-145 => udev}/udev.rules | 0
>> meta/recipes-core/udev/udev_145.bb | 55 --
>> meta/recipes-core/udev/udev_164.bb | 4 +-
>> .../qt4-graphics-system/qt4-graphics-system_1.0.bb | 24 +
>> meta/recipes-qt/qt4/qt4-embedded.inc | 3 +-
>> meta/recipes-qt/qt4/qt4-x11-free.inc | 3 +-
>> 42 files changed, 208 insertions(+), 2113 deletions(-)
>> delete mode 100644 meta/recipes-core/udev/files/fix-alignment.patch
>> delete mode 100755 meta/recipes-core/udev/files/init
>> delete mode 100644 meta/recipes-core/udev/files/local.rules
>> delete mode 100644 meta/recipes-core/udev/files/noasmlinkage.patch
>> delete mode 100644 meta/recipes-core/udev/files/permissions.rules
>> delete mode 100644 meta/recipes-core/udev/files/tmpfs.patch
>> delete mode 100644 meta/recipes-core/udev/files/udev-cache
>> delete mode 100644 meta/recipes-core/udev/files/udev.rules
>> delete mode 100644 meta/recipes-core/udev/files/udev_network_queue.sh
>> delete mode 100644 meta/recipes-core/udev/files/udevsynthesize.patch
>> delete mode 100644 meta/recipes-core/udev/files/udevsynthesize.sh
>> delete mode 100644 meta/recipes-core/udev/udev-145/enable-gudev.patch
>> delete mode 100644 meta/recipes-core/udev/udev-145/init
>> delete mode 100644 meta/recipes-core/udev/udev-145/local.rules
>> delete mode 100644 meta/recipes-core/udev/udev-145/noasmlinkage.patch
>> delete mode 100644 meta/recipes-core/udev/udev-145/unbreak.patch
>> delete mode 100644 meta/recipes-core/udev/udev-164/init
>> delete mode 100644 meta/recipes-core/udev/udev-164/permissions.rules
>> delete mode 100644 meta/recipes-core/udev/udev-164/run.rules
>> delete mode 100644 meta/recipes-core/udev/udev-164/udev.rules
>> rename meta/recipes-core/udev/{files =>
>> udev-extraconf}/mount.blacklist (100%)
>> delete mode 100644 meta/recipes-core/udev/udev-new.inc
>> rename meta/recipes-core/udev/{files => udev}/devfs-udev.rules (100%)
>> create mode 100644 meta/recipes-core/udev/udev/init
>> rename meta/recipes-core/udev/{files => udev}/links.conf (100%)
>> rename meta/recipes-core/udev/{udev-164 => udev}/local.rules (100%)
>> rename meta/recipes-core/udev/{files => udev}/mount.sh (100%)
>> rename meta/recipes-core/udev/{files => udev}/network.sh (100%)
>> rename meta/recipes-core/udev/{udev-145 => udev}/permissions.rules (100%)
>> rename meta/recipes-core/udev/{udev-145 => udev}/run.rules (100%)
>> rename meta/recipes-core/udev/{files => udev}/udev-166-v4l1-1.patch
>> (100%)
>> create mode 100644 meta/recipes-core/udev/udev/udev-cache
>> create mode 100644 meta/recipes-core/udev/udev/udev-cache.default
>> rename meta/recipes-core/udev/{udev-145 => udev}/udev.rules (100%)
>> delete mode 100644 meta/recipes-core/udev/udev_145.bb
>> create mode 100644
>> meta/recipes-qt/qt4-graphics-system/qt4-graphics-system_1.0.bb
>>
>
> _______________________________________________
> Openembedded-core mailing list
> Openembedded-core at lists.openembedded.org
> http://lists.linuxtogo.org/cgi-bin/mailman/listinfo/openembedded-core
>




More information about the Openembedded-core mailing list